Flat Slab Analysis and Design

Flat Slab Analysis and Design

Users  5

Flat Slab Analysis and Design designs beamless concrete slab floors (flat slab or waffle slab) in accordance with ACI 318. The analysis and design follow the equivalent frame analysis method of the ACI code, which considers a one-bay wide strip of the floor system as a continuous frame.

Pile Group Analysis

Pile Group Analysis

Users  2

Pile Group Analysis is the most advanced pile group analysis program available. While other programs use simple rigid body principles to determine the distribution of forces to individual piles, Pile Group Analysis does a comprehensive analysis of the pile-soil interaction to determine the distribution.

Static Pile Analysis

Static Pile Analysis

Users  2

Static Pile Analysis is a finite-element modeling program for soil-structure interaction problems. While often used to determine behavior of a pile, the program can also be used to analyze poles/posts, sheet piles, walls and just about any other structure that relies on lateral soil support and/or skin friction for stability.

Shear Wall Analysis

Shear Wall Analysis

Users  1

Analyze a building which is laterally supported by shear walls for the shears and moments in each of the shear walls. Loads due to wind and seismic conditions can be input in two perpendicular directions. Lateral loads are distributed based on the combined flexural and shear stiffness of the individual wall elements.
